Description of EVE at 433 East 13th Street
A stellar example of the East Village’s dramatic 21st century renaissance is the eight-story, mid-block rental building at 433 East 13th Street known as EVE. Built by Mack Real Estate Group, Benenson Capital Partners and Urban Development Partners and designed by SLCE Architects, the building’s 113 apartments feature interiors by CL-OTH–and a large courtyard mural by Remko Heemskerk depicting some of the neighborhood’s most iconic bands. Apartments are studios, one- and two-bedroom units with oversized windows and open kitchens with sleek integrated appliances. Amenities at this thoroughly modern residence start at the top with a landscaped roof deck furnished with a sprawling lawn, grilling area and outdoor TV and sound system. Additional amenities include a billiards room, lounge, fitness center with outdoor activity area, bike room, concierge and pet grooming station. You won’t have to go far to shop at Trader Joe’s (the building’s retail tenant), and a Target just opened a few doors down. Tompkins Square Park with its famous dog run is three blocks away. The surrounding neighborhood is filled with restaurants and bars including Momofuku Noodle Bar, Cafe Mogador, Xi’an Famous Foods and Please Don’t Tell. The 4 express and 6 subways are three blocks away at Astor Place, and the L is nearby for travel to north Brooklyn (or Eighth Avenue).
